About #DBFF57

The precise color #DBFF57 is an excellent choice for modern design projects. It is closely associated with the named CSS color Yellowgreen. Its digital footprint relies on 219 parts red, 255 parts green, and 87 parts blue light.

While screens use RGB, printing presses rely on Cyan, Magenta, Yellow, and Key (black). The color uses 14% Cyan, 0% Magenta, 66% Yellow, and 0% Black. Always request a physical proof before doing a large print run with this exact code.

Ensuring your text is legible against this background is a key part of web design. The calculated luminance score dictates that #000000 typography is the safest choice. Strict adherence to these ratios protects visually impaired users from unreadable interfaces.

Color Space Conversions

HEX#DBFF57
RGB219, 255, 87
HSL72.9°, 100.0%, 67.1%
CMYK14%, 0%, 66%, 0%
HSV72.9°, 65.9%, 100.0%
LAB94.9, -33.5, 73.2
XYZ66.7, 87.3, 22.3
Decimal14417751
